Pagini recente »
Diferențe pentru problema/palindrom3 între reviziile 39 și 40
|
Diferențe pentru utilizator/manolea_teodor_stefan între reviziile 6 și 8
|
Diferențe pentru utilizator/traian_7109 între reviziile 105 și 106
|
2022-03-31-clasa-6-concurs19-cursuri-performanta
|
Diferențe pentru problema/inversiuni între reviziile 22 și 20
Nu există diferențe între titluri.
Diferențe între conținut:
Două numere dintr-o permutare, a[~i~] și a[~j~], formează o inversiune dacă a[~i~] > a[~j~] și i < j.
De exemplu, în permutarea 4 2 7 1 5 6 3, există in total 10 inversiuni între numerele de pe pozițiile : 4–2, 4–1, 4–3, 2–1, 7–1, 7–5, 7–6, 7–3, 5–3, 6–3.
De exemplu, în permutarea 4 2 7 1 5 6 3, există in total 10 inversiuni între numerele de pe poziyiile : 4–2, 4–1, 4–3, 2–1, 7–1, 7–5, 7–6, 7–3, 5–3, 6–3.
h2. Cerință
Pe prima linie a fișierului $inversiuni.in$ se va afla valoarea lui [*n*], iar pe a doua linie cele [*n*] numere (delimitate prin spațiu) care formeaza permutarea.
h2. Date de ieșire
h2. Date de ieșire (in fisierul "inversiuni.out" )
În fișierul $inversiuni.out$ veți afișa un singur număr, anume numărul total de inversiuni ale permutării date la intrare.
Nu există diferențe între securitate.